Review of Metal Roofing
Metal roof covering has actually gained popularity recently because of its longevity and visual appeal. When you select metal roofing, you're opting for a material that can hold up against harsh weather conditions, consisting of hefty rain, snow, and high winds.
Unlike traditional tiles, steel ro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years with minimal maintenance, making them a lasting financial investment.
An additional benefit of steel roof covering is its energy effectiveness. You'll find that numerous metal roofs are made to mirror solar heat, which can help in reducing your air conditioning prices during warm summertime.
And also, metal roofs are often made from recycled materials, which interest environmentally conscious property owners.
In terms of layout, steel roof is available in different styles, colors, and coatings, enabling you to personalize your home's look. Whether you like a streamlined modern appearance or a rustic charm, you'll have options to match your vision.
Ultimately, metal roof is immune to insects and rot, providing you peace of mind that your roofing will continue to be intact for many years.
With all these advantages, it's no wonder several home owners are making the button to metal roof.
Overview of Roof Shingles Roofing
When taking into consideration roof alternatives, shingle roof covering continues to be a preferred option amongst homeowners for its affordability and adaptability. Tiles can be found in numerous materials, consisting of asphalt, wood, and fiberglass, enabling you to pick a style that fits your home's aesthetic and budget. Asphalt shingles are one of the most usual type, understood for their cost-effectiveness and convenience of installment.
Among the main benefits of tile roof is its vast array of colors and designs. This flexibility indicates you can easily match your roofing system to your home's outside. In addition, shingle roofing systems typically have a life expectancy of 20 to three decades, relying on the material and upkeep, making them a practical long-lasting financial investment.
Installation is generally quick and simple, which can save you on labor costs. You can frequently locate local professionals that specialize in roof shingles roof, giving you choices for affordable prices.

Key Comparisons and Considerations
Picking between steel and roof shingles roofing includes several vital comparisons and factors to consider that can significantly influence your decision.
Initially, think of resilience. Steel roofings can last 40 to 70 years, while asphalt shingles normally last 15 to three decades. This longevity implies that although steel may have a higher upfront price, it can conserve you cash in the future.
Next off, think about upkeep. Metal roofing systems require less maintenance, resisting mold and mildew and mold, while shingles could require a lot more regular inspections and repairs.
Climate resistance is an additional crucial aspect. Metal roofing systems handle extreme weather condition well, consisting of heavy rainfall and snow, whereas shingles can be susceptible to wind damages.
Appearances also contribute. Roofing shingles offer a typical look that lots of house owners prefer, while steel roofing comes in different styles and shades, allowing for more personalization.
Last but not least, evaluate insulation and energy efficiency. Metal roofings mirror warmth, keeping your home colder, while roof shingles might absorb much more warmth, impacting your power bills.
Ultimately, evaluate these variables against your budget plan, local environment, and personal preferences to make the best roof choice for your home.
